Hi Anon and thanks for your question.

You may be dealing with some shifts in the timing for your period. While we are generally taught to look for a 28 day cycle, which is the average cycle, a normal cycle is anywhere between 21 and 35 days.

What you experienced on Oct 31, which lasted one day, may have been old blood from your previous period rather than a new, separate period.

When was your last visit with your gynecologist? If it's been a while, and these changes are bothering you, it would be a good time to schedule a visit and get checked out for your own peace of mind and well being.
